diff options
author | Aapo Tahkola <aet@rasterburn.org> | 2005-10-26 16:42:06 +0000 |
---|---|---|
committer | Aapo Tahkola <aet@rasterburn.org> | 2005-10-26 16:42:06 +0000 |
commit | 4dc3249f0d800f9e36ee11ec5c00351e67dbeee3 (patch) | |
tree | 35c249c6e240c15d55d98fca862d9fcbf371d2f5 /src/mesa/drivers/dri/r300/r300_maos.h | |
parent | 23f076ca67912c1a8ddd7a43f8a3e34c4bc5128a (diff) |
Sync with my local tree.
Changes to current operation:
-Elts are no longer converted to 16-bit format
-Cube maps
Diffstat (limited to 'src/mesa/drivers/dri/r300/r300_maos.h')
-rw-r--r-- | src/mesa/drivers/dri/r300/r300_maos.h |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/src/mesa/drivers/dri/r300/r300_maos.h b/src/mesa/drivers/dri/r300/r300_maos.h index f76c94a219..c75589085b 100644 --- a/src/mesa/drivers/dri/r300/r300_maos.h +++ b/src/mesa/drivers/dri/r300/r300_maos.h @@ -40,8 +40,17 @@ W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#include "r300_context.h" -extern void r300EmitElts(GLcontext * ctx, GLuint *elts, unsigned long n_elts); +extern void r300EmitElts(GLcontext * ctx, void *elts, unsigned long n_elts, int elt_size); extern void r300EmitArrays(GLcontext * ctx, GLboolean immd); + +#ifdef RADEON_VTXFMT_A +extern void r300EmitArraysVtx(GLcontext * ctx, GLboolean immd); +#endif + +#ifdef USER_BUFFERS +void r300UseArrays(GLcontext * ctx); +#endif + extern void r300ReleaseArrays(GLcontext * ctx); #endif |